Trafficking of Children for Organised Begging

A Study of Child Beggars in Sri Lanka

The present study looks at the demand side of trafficking children for begging. The purposeof this research is to study the conditions and internal dynamics in the labour market that facilitates or inhibits trafficking in children for begging. It investigates whether there is a demands for labour, services and products by employers, clients and traffickers of child beggars. Blurb Source: Extracted from the introduction of the study
